摘要
Recently, both acid and neutral nucleases acre separated and purified from germinated alfalfa seeds (Yupsanis et al., 1996). In this work, the neutral alfalfa nuclease was further purified to near homogeneity with a modified purification procedure and additional properties of both enzymes were studied. Nuclease extracts of SDS/PAGE and IEF gels revealed that the acid as well as the neutral nuclease hydrolyzed both ssDNA and RNA and showed nicking action against plasmid DNA (pTZ18R). Also, both nucleases were accompanied by 3' nucleotidase activity. In comparison with the acid nuclease the mode of the neutral nuclease action towards ssDNA and a synthetic thirty-sixth-deoxynucleotide (d-(32)pGpApTpCpCpApG-pApAp GpTpApGpApApGpCpApGpApTpCpTpCpGpApTpCpCpApGppTpCpTpG) was more endonucleolytic. The order of bond hydrolysis of dir above deoxynucleotide was Cp down arrow C >Cp down arrow A >Gp down arrow T >Gp down arrow C for the acid nuclease and A down arrow pT>C down arrow pA = T down arrow pC for the neutral nuclease. Both enzymes consist of one polypeptide chain of 37krDa with pI 4.9 (acid nuclease) and of 41 kDa with pI 5.3 (neutral nuclease). Based on the properties of alfalfa endonucleases we concluded chat their structural conformation should have common aspects bur different catalytic sites.
